Output 42b4632b9f193357bea81bbd28efe762c606709076428beec0d9d8cb98f5cac7:1

value
509333796
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66b56fcbfec7207a2d24c919bde0b3219d368520 OP_EQUALVERIFY OP_CHECKSIG
address
1AN5H1atb2HYAWZMJHhp93yu4rpdaL4NML
transaction
42b4632b9f193357bea81bbd28efe762c606709076428beec0d9d8cb98f5cac7
confirmations
592575
spent
true